WebSep 24, 2024 · According to the survey, during 2024: Over 41% of high school students reported feelings of sadness or hopelessness for two or more weeks in a row (30% males; 53% females). In the 30 days before the survey, 32% of students reported that their mental health was not good most of the time or always. WebDec 14, 2024 · In 2024, 30% of female respondents said they had seriously considered suicide, compared with 23% in 2024 and 15% a decade earlier, in 2011. In 2024, 14% of males had seriously considered committing suicide, compared with 15% in 2024 and 14% in 2011. From DPI’s presentation to the CFTF December 12, 2024. WebAug 20, 2024 · Sexual Risk Behaviors. In the 2024 results, the percentage of high school students who have ever had sex declined from 46% in 2009 to 38% in 2024. The percentage of students who had four or more sexual partners also declined from 14% in 2009 to 9% in 2024.
